Children of Men

2006 · Alfonso Cuarón · Science Fiction Thriller · 1h 49m · R
“The year 2027: the last days of the human race. No child has been born for 18 years. He must protect our only hope.”
7.6 PANEL

In 2027, in a chaotic world in which humans can no longer procreate, a former activist agrees to help transport a miraculously pregnant woman to a sanctuary at sea, where her child's birth may help scientists save the future of humankind.

Directed by Alfonso Cuarón

Only on Popcorn Jury

💰 Cost $76M, grossed $70.6M.

🎬 A UK production.

🏆 Nominated for 3 Oscars. 49 wins & 89 nominations total.
